G'day! I haven't scrolled far enough to see if anyone else figured it out, but the reason the colours read from right to left is the RAMP > TYPE. If it's left at HORIZONTAL it reads red through to green and then through to red again. Changing it to RADIAL immediately corrects the problem. I completely understood the Simple Feedback in this video. ru-vid.com/video/%D0%B2%D0%B8%D0%B4%D0%B5%D0%BE-JkKHKsY31no.html What "level" does is shorten the lifespan of the feedback, which is why the opacity should be 0.95, and it is connected to the render through a composition.
